The 45th annual Telly Awards
Silver Telly Winner in Social Video - Art Direction

The Extraordinary Lives Foundation is thrilled and honored to be awarded with a 2024 Silver Telly Awards for Social Video Production in Art Direction for our short animated film, Piggie Bear and the Lost Star. This is an incredible achievement as we were ranked among 13,000 entries with the chosen winners representing the most innovative stories being told across all screens. Telly Award winners represent work from some of the most respected advertising agencies, television stations, production companies and publishers from around the world.

The Telly Awards was founded in 1979 to honors excellence in video and television across all screens. Today, The Telly Awards celebrate the best work in the video medium in an exciting new era of the moving image on and offline.
